The technical difficulty of these problems is that the optimization problem is not convex due to the truncation. We develop a transformation technique to convert the original non-convex optimization problems to convex ones while preservation some desired structural properties, which are useful for characterizing optimal decision policies and conducting comparative statics. Our transformation technique provides a unified approach to analyze a broad class of models in inventory control and revenue management. In additional, we develop efficient algorithms to solve the transformed stochastic optimization problem.","abstract_has_math":false,"creators":["Gao, Xiangyu"],"institution":"University of Illinois at Urbana-Champaign","degree_name":"Ph.D.","degree_level":"Dissertation","degree_discipline":"Industrial Engineering","degree_department":null,"school":null,"contributors":["Chen, Xin","Lim, Michael","Wang, Qiong","Xin, Linwei"],"advisors":[],"committee_chairs":[],"committee_members":[],"year":2017,"date_issued":"2017-09-29T16:39:09Z","date_published":"2017-09-29T16:39:09Z","updated_at":"2026-07-22T22:24:35Z","subjects":["Stochastic optimization","Convexity","Supply capacity uncertainty","Revenue management"],"languages":["en"],"rights":["Copyright 2017 Xiangyu Gao"],"rights_urls":[],"identifier_entries":[]},"links":{"outbound_url":"http://hdl.handle.net/2142/98234","outbound_label":"Handle","outbound_source":"dc:identifier"},"metadata_groups":[{"id":"people","label":"People","entries":[{"key":"dc:contributor","label":"Contributor","values":["Chen, Xin","Lim, Michael","Wang, Qiong","Xin, Linwei"]},{"key":"dc:creator","label":"Author","values":["Gao, Xiangyu"]}]},{"id":"academic_context","label":"Academic Context","entries":[{"key":"dc:date","label":"Dc Date","values":["2017-09-29T16:39:09Z","2019-09-30T09:15:26Z","2017-06-26","2017-08"]},{"key":"dc:type","label":"Dc Type","values":["text"]},{"key":"thesis:degree_discipline","label":"Discipline","values":["Industrial Engineering"]},{"key":"thesis:degree_level","label":"Degree Level","values":["Dissertation"]},{"key":"thesis:degree_name","label":"Degree Name","values":["Ph.D."]},{"key":"thesis:institution_name","label":"Thesis Institution Name","values":["University of Illinois at Urbana-Champaign"]}]},{"id":"subjects_keywords","label":"Subjects and Keywords","entries":[{"key":"dc:subject","label":"Dc Subject","values":["Stochastic optimization","Convexity","Supply capacity uncertainty","Revenue management"]}]},{"id":"language_rights","label":"Language and Rights","entries":[{"key":"dc:language","label":"Dc Language","values":["en"]},{"key":"dc:rights","label":"Dc Rights","values":["Copyright 2017 Xiangyu Gao"]}]},{"id":"identifiers","label":"Identifiers","entries":[{"key":"dc:identifier","label":"Identifier","values":["http://hdl.handle.net/2142/98234"]}]},{"id":"additional","label":"Additional Metadata","entries":[{"key":"dc:description","label":"Description","values":["We study stochastic optimization problems with decisions truncated by random variables and its applications in operations management.
